Punnany Massif Concert, Mupa, 29 December
- 27 Dec 2016 5:53 PM
- entertainment
Over the last decade, Punnany Massif has attracted a broad following with its unique blend of sounds mixed according to a unique formula. Today, this combination, constructed around acoustic instruments with a band playing hip-pop sung in Hungarian and melding funk-rock, folk music and electronica, has grown from an exotic curiosity to become one of the key trends in Hungarian music.

Hungary October Gross Wages Up 5.4%
- 21 Dec 2016 11:00 AM
- business
The average gross wage in Hungary rose by an annual 5.4% to 262,200 forints (EUR 835) in September, the Central Statistical Office (KSH) said. Net wage growth outpaced the increase, climbing 7% to 174,393 forints due to a one percentage point cut in the personal income tax rate from January.
